AdipoGen animal-free recombinant monoclonal antibodies (RecMAbs)

Monday, 26 August, 2019 | Supplied by: Sapphire Bioscience


AdipoGen develops recombinant monoclonal antibodies (RecMAbs) without the use of animals. The antibodies are created using an in vitro technology, antibody phage display — an alternative to the hybridoma technology that circumvents the limitations of the immune system. Antibodies developed by antibody phage display technology use human naïve antibody gene libraries.

There are many advantages to using RecMAbs recombinant antibodies instead of traditional antibodies, according to the company, including: no requirement of sacrificing animals in an animal facility; economical production and permanent storage of DNA clones; sequence-defined antibodies allowing reproducibility in experiments; and use of a single-chain antibody fragment to reconfigure a RecMAb into a full-length IgG construct for research purposes.
